  • Page 13: Charging Your Phone

    Charging your phone Slide back the cover of the charger connector on the side of your GD900. Insert the charger and plug it into a mains electricity socket. Your GD900 must be charged until the “Battery full“ message appears on the screen. NOTE: The battery must be fully charged initially to improve battery lifetime.

  • Page 19 get in touch with your gd900 The User Interface is based on four types of Homescreens. To swap between the home screens just wipe quickly over display from left to right or from right to left. NOTE: Use flicking to navigate without disturbing the display area.

  • Page 78: Listening To The Radio

    TIP! To improve radio reception, extend the headset cord, which functions as the radio aerial. Warning! If you connect the headset not specifically made for it to the phone, the radio reception can be interfered. LG GD900 | User Guide...
